Summary
Ryland Grace spends weeks explaining the theory of relativity to Rocky, who initially struggles but eventually accepts it as the explanation for his long journey. The two then embark on an immense engineering task: creating a 10‑kilometer chain. Using a geometric progression of molds, they produce 200,000 links and assemble them in parallel sections. Rocky designs a sampler probe that can seal and maintain the temperature of an air sample. To deploy it, they slow the Hail Mary above Adrian and release the chain. After successfully capturing air from the Astrophage breeding zone, Ryland performs a dangerous EVA to retrieve the sample using a winch that disassembles the chain. During retrieval, the ship experiences violent shaking. Ryland discovers a massive hull breach caused by infrared heat from the engines reflecting off Adrian's atmosphere. The breach exposes Astrophage fuel to space, causing uncontrolled thrust and a deadly spin. Ryland jettisons fuel bays, but the centripetal force crushes him. Rocky enters the human partition, cuts Ryland free, then collapses from heat exposure, seemingly dead.

Character Development
Ryland Grace: Demonstrates relentless persistence and manual skill under extreme pressure. His ability to adapt to zero‑g chain assembly and EVA in gravity shows growth from academic to hands‑on problem solver. His final thoughts of failure toward Earth highlight his sense of responsibility.
Rocky: Showcases exceptional engineering talent by designing the sampler and winch. More importantly, he performs an act of immense self‑sacrifice: knowingly entering the hot, deadly human environment to save his friend. His final words ("Save Earth… Save Erid…") underline his commitment to both species.
Themes, Symbols, or Motifs
Sacrifice and Friendship: Rocky's willingness to die for Ryland represents the deep bond formed between two beings from different worlds. It transforms their partnership from a pragmatic alliance into a genuine friendship.
Scientific Problem‑Solving: The chapter is a showcase of applied physics and engineering—from chain manufacturing to orbital mechanics. The winch design exemplifies elegant solutions to complex problems.
Unpredictable Consequences: Despite careful planning, the IR blowback melts the hull, a failure of heat conduction. This reinforces the theme that space exploration carries unknown risks.
Perspective and Scale: Ryland's description of making 200,000 links and dreaming of chain emphasizes the monotonous but crucial labor behind grand scientific achievements.

Study Questions and Answers
1. Why does Ryland initially believe the hull cannot melt? Ryland assumed the Astrophage cooling system would absorb any heat, but he failed to account for the time required for heat to conduct through the metal. The outer layer melted faster than heat could reach the Astrophage.
2. How does the winch retrieve the chain without tangling? The winch uses a gear that catches each link, rotates it 180 degrees, and slides it past its neighbor to release it. This disassembles the chain link by link, allowing each freed link to fall away harmlessly into the planet below.
